As we enter the final lap of the Presidential and Parliamentary Election, Joy FM, your Election Headquarters has unveiled three new exciting programmes designed to inform and educate the electorate on the electoral process and a content analysis of the manifestos of the various political parties.
Tune in to Joy FM every weekday at 2-3pm as we bring you “The Election Forum” which provides a platform for civil society organizations such as IDEG, CDD, IMANI & THE ARK FOUNDATION to discuss electoral issues.
At 7pm every weekday except Thursday, we will bring you “Decision 2012” with Paul Adom Otchere. He will bring you the views and opinions of all those who matter in the upcoming election.
Also, we bring you “From Our Correspondents”, a programme that brings you election related stories compiled by our correspondents across the regions. Make a date with us every weekday at 10pm for a rare insight into the backroom campaign maneuverings.
